RIDGELAND, Miss. - The Lynn University women's tennis team continued its dominant stretch with a 4-0 victory against Delta State, Friday afternoon.
With the win, the Fighting Knights improve to 6-2 overall this campaign.
HOW IT HAPPENED:
- Lynn set the tone early by claiming the doubles point with victories on the first and third courts
- At No. 1 doublesÂ
Carla Galmiche and Kristin Younes earned a 6-1 victory over Amelia Ciesielczyk and Trinity Ly
-
Hailey Lizano and
Meadow Garcia followed with a 6-3 win at No. 3 doubles against Angela Moreno and Lena Kuehn to secure the point for the Fighting Knights
- In singles play
Salma Djoubri extended Lynn's lead with a 6-3, 6-4 victory in the first flight against Ly
- At No. 5 singlesÂ
Lea Cakarevic battled through a three-set match to defeat Kuehn 1-6, 6-3, 6-4
- Lizano clinched the match for the Blue and White with a 6-3, 6-4 win in the sixth flight
